1. Understanding the Two Asset Classes
Before comparing, let’s understand the basic difference.
Commercial Fractional Real Estate
Includes:
-
Office spaces
-
Co-working spaces
-
Retail shops
-
Warehouses
-
Showrooms
-
Logistics centers
-
Industrial real estate
-
Hotels
-
Mixed-use commercial buildings
Investors collectively purchase a commercial income-producing building.
Residential Fractional Real Estate
Includes:
-
Apartments
-
Condos
-
Studio flats
-
Luxury villas
-
Vacation homes
-
Airbnb properties
-
Rental residential assets
Investors collectively purchase a residential property that generates rent or vacation income.

4. Rental Yield Comparison (Global Averages)
⭐ Commercial Fractional Real Estate – Higher Rental Yield
| Region | Commercial Yield |
|---|---|
| USA | 7% – 12% |
| UAE (Dubai) | 8% – 12% |
| Singapore | 5% – 8% |
| UK | 6% – 10% |
| India | 7% – 10% |
| Europe | 6% – 9% |
Residential Fractional Real Estate – Lower Rental Yield
| Region | Residential Yield |
|---|---|
| USA | 3% – 6% |
| UAE | 5% – 8% |
| Singapore | 2.5% – 4% |
| UK | 3% – 5% |
| India | 2% – 4% |
| Europe | 3% – 5% |
Verdict (Rental Income):
🏆 Commercial fractional real estate wins by a huge margin
Because:
-
Corporate tenants pay more
-
Lease durations are longer
-
Maintenance is lower
-
Vacancy risk is lower
5. Appreciation Comparison (Long-Term Capital Growth)
Let’s examine how both asset types appreciate over time.
Residential Appreciation – Higher Long-Term Growth
Reasons:
-
Demand driven by population growth
-
Emotional buying behavior
-
Limited land supply
-
Government housing incentives
-
Urban migration
Average appreciation:
| Region | Residential Appreciation |
|---|---|
| USA | 3% – 6% |
| UAE | 4% – 10% |
| Singapore | 3% – 7% |
| India | 4% – 8% |
| Europe | 2% – 6% |
Commercial Appreciation – Moderate But Stable
Reasons:
-
Depends on commercial demand
-
Tied to business cycles
-
Higher sensitivity to economic slowdown
Average appreciation:
| Region | Commercial Appreciation |
|---|---|
| USA | 3% – 5% |
| UAE | 3% – 6% |
| Singapore | 2% – 4% |
| India | 2% – 5% |
| Europe | 1% – 4% |
Verdict (Appreciation):
🏆 Residential fractional real estate wins
Because residential markets grow faster in the long term.

8. Lease Duration Comparison
Commercial leases typically:
-
5 to 9 years
-
Lock-ins of 3+ years
-
Annual rent escalation
-
Corporate tenants
Residential leases:
-
6 to 24 months
-
No lock-in (in many cases)
-
Individuals, students, families
Verdict:
🏆 Commercial = more lease stability
🏆 Residential = more lease flexibility
